Output 91016128876962cb72d4172ae620f5203d1050bb89359ab649cece60eb028469:1

value
34667354
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ef64cf0900d1f7c1cd441239ce275600b02c3b8b OP_EQUALVERIFY OP_CHECKSIG
address
1NpoGALH6MAreuNX8vEMTDwCd9ETvcYgtq
transaction
91016128876962cb72d4172ae620f5203d1050bb89359ab649cece60eb028469
spent
true